Head of Arab Parliament denounces recent Houthi genocide in Hodeida
[04/12/2020 06:22]
CAIRO - SABA
The Head of Arab Parliament Adel al-Assoumi has denounced the malicious bloody massacre committed by Iran-backed Houthi militia against commercial compound in Hodeida Thursday by mortar shelling, killing and injuring a number of workers.
In a release to him on Friday, al-Assoumi confirmed that committing this terrorist crime by Houthi militia three days after similar bloody massacre in Duraihim District in Hodeida, killing and injuring dozens of civilians most of them children and women, reflects Houthi blatant challenge to all humanitarian principles and international laws.
He also confirmed solidarity and support of the parliament to the Republic of Yemen for taking any measure to deter Houthi militia's terrorism and crimes.
He called upon the international community and the Security Council to take imminent action for protecting innocent civilians of Yemeni people and making an end to Houthi militia's continuous humanitarian violations.
The Head of the Arab Parliament expressed his profound condolences to Yemeni people and families of the victims of these terrorist massacre and hoped quick recovery to the injured.
